Overview
MBR2060CTP from Diodes Incorporated is a 20A dual common-cathode Schottky barrier rectifier in ITO-220S package, rated for 60V peak reverse voltage, with 0.70V typical forward voltage at 10A/25°C and 2000V isolation between heatsink tab and cathode. It delivers soft fast switching and low conduction loss in high-frequency DC-DC output stages.
For engineers reviewing the MBR2060CTP datasheet, MBR2060CTP pinout, MBR2060CTP application, or MBR2060CTP equivalent, key selection criteria include per-leg 10A average current rating, 170A non-repetitive surge capability, thermal resistance of 3°C/W (junction-to-case), isolated heatsink tab compatibility, and derating behavior above 25°C ambient.
Technical Context
This dual-anode, single-cathode Schottky rectifier integrates two independent 10A legs sharing a common cathode terminal and electrically isolated heatsink tab. Its soft recovery minimizes EMI in switching power supplies, while the 60V VRRM rating targets 48V-input and 12V-output DC-DC converters.
The device operates across –65°C to +175°C junction temperature range and requires heatsinking per RθJA = 16°C/W (per element) when used at full 10A/leg. Isolation voltage of 2000VAC (1 min) enables safe mounting to grounded metal chassis without additional insulation.

FAQ
What does "CTP" signify in MBR2060CTP?
The "CTP" suffix denotes the ITO-220S package variant with electrically isolated heatsink tab and UL 1557 certification (E94661). It differentiates this version from the standard ITO-220 "CT" variant where the tab is internally connected to the cathode.
Can MBR2060CTP be used in place of MBR2060CT?
No-MBR2060CTP's isolated tab is internally disconnected from all terminals, whereas MBR2060CT's tab connects directly to the cathode. Substituting them without verifying tab grounding requirements risks short circuits or compromised safety isolation.
Why is MBR2060CTP marked obsolete, and is it still manufacturable?
Diodes Incorporated discontinued MBR2060CTP per DS31794 Rev. 5 (Oct 2015) due to product line rationalization. It is no longer in active production, but Aetrix Electronics maintains legacy inventory and supports traceable, tested stock for continuity-critical programs.
What thermal derating applies above 25°C ambient?
Per Figure 5, average forward current per leg must be linearly derated from 10A at 25°C to 0A at 125°C ambient, assuming RθJA = 16°C/W per element. At 85°C ambient, maximum continuous current per leg is approximately 6.25A.
